Current asylum system broken say several EU countries

Letter sent to the presidents of the Commission and the Council

Redazione Ansa

(ANSA) - BELGRADE, FEB 7 - "In our opinion, the current asylum system is broken, and it primarily benefits cynical human traffickers who profit from the misfortunes of women, men, and children," the governments of Denmark, Lithuania, Latvia, Estonia, Slovakia, Greece, Malta, and Austria wrote to the Commission and Council presidents on the eve of the extraordinary council.

"We urge the Commission to present a comprehensive European approach for all migration routes, with the goal of addressing pull factors, including through necessary legal and technical adjustments." (ANSA).
